Waterford Nationals    Pitchers Rally Together In Shutout Victory Against Albany Thunder  

Waterford Nationals  defeated Albany Thunder    4-0 on Sunday at Waterford as two pitchers combined to throw a shutout. Justin Sargent and Dylan Becker each pitched for Waterford Nationals   in the game. Sargent struck out Darlin Lora to get the last out.
Waterford Nationals   got on the board in the first inning after JJ Hunter hit a sacrifice fly, scoring one run.
Waterford Nationals   added to their early lead in the bottom of the second inning after Zac Mravlija homered to center field, and Donovan Lettierei singled down the right field line, each scoring one run.
A single by Michael Mann extended the Waterford Nationals  lead to 4-0 in the bottom of the third inning.
Becker started on the mound for Waterford Nationals  . The pitcher surrendered four hits and zero runs over six and two-thirds innings, striking out eight and walking five. Gio P opened the game for Albany Thunder  . The starter allowed five hits and three runs over one and two-thirds innings, striking out none and walking two. Waterford Nationals   accumulated nine hits in the game. Brody Becker and Brad Curtis were a force together in the lineup, as they each collected two hits for Waterford Nationals   while hitting back-to-back. Mann, Hunter, Mravlija, and Lettierei each drove in one run for Waterford Nationals  .
Bruce Valentin went 2-for-4 at the plate to lead Albany Thunder ATL 26 in hits. Albany Thunder    turned one double play in the game.
